Ages Offered: 6U & 7U (Coach Pitch), 8U (Modified Coach Pitch), 9U, 10U, 11U, 12U & 13/14U.

Age Determination Date: Age as of May 1, 2025.

 

Approximate Number of Games in Season: 10-22 including playoffs. Games will be overscheduled to allow for as many games as possible without creating the need to reschedule potential games lost due to weather related issues.  There are no guaranteed minimum number of games.

 

Format for League Games:  AA Season starting in April for all ages, typically one (1) game every Saturday and one (1) game every Sunday per weekend will be played.

Format for Championship: Two (2) games/double elimination playoff with a single elimination championship game.

 

Number of Practices per Week: Two (2) 90-minute practices per week within the town of Castle Rock from March - June. Optionally, teams are permitted to practice more than two (2) times per week if practice times are available. Below is our general guideline for when each age group will practice.
